Paraprofessional (Instructional Assistant)
MOESC is seeking qualified applicants for a part-time paraprofessional (instructional assistant) position at Holy Spirit High School for the 2026-27 school year. Part-time (10 month) hourly rate: $21.65. Paid sick and personal days.
Qualifications:
- High school diploma preferred
- Experience with children in a school setting
- Good organizational skills
- Basic knowledge of computer applications and email
- Good interpersonal skills with children and adults
- Ability to pass a criminal history check and show proof of US citizenship or legal resident alien status
- Ability to communicate and have command of the English language
- Alternatives to the above qualifications as the superintendent or his/her designee may find appropriate and acceptable
Reports to:
Supervisor of Student Services or appropriate administrator as designated by the superintendent.
Performance responsibilities:
- Assist students in physical tasks such as putting on and taking off outerwear, moving from room to room, using the lavatory, and toileting students when necessary
- Perform simple errands and tasks for students such as sharpening pencils, carrying lunch trays, scribing, etc.
- Work collaboratively with the teacher in helping students to reach their instructional goals and educational milestones
- Under the supervision of the classroom teacher, work with students to reinforce material initially introduced by the teacher
- Accompany student(s) from class to class around the building
- Assist and support students in reaching their academic, social, and emotional goals
- Make effort to establish an appropriate and professional relationship with the student(s)
- Maintain good attendance, appearance, and punctuality
- Assist students, as appropriate, when the student has physical limitations or is wheelchair bound
- Meet student(s) at school bus at the start of the student's school day and ensure student(s) are safely placed on the school bus at the end of the day, when necessary
- Perform tasks as assigned by the supervisor or his/her designee
Physical requirements:
- Sitting, standing, reaching, walking, lifting, bending, crouching, kneeling, climbing, pushing, pulling, finger dexterity, carrying, repetitive motions, speaking, listening, visual acuity and the ability to lift and/or move up to 50 pounds
Terms of employment:
Part-time, 10 months
Evaluation:
Performance of this job will be evaluated in accordance with the provisions of the MOESC's board's policy on evaluation of support personnel. EOE
